Mortgage Originator

4 months ago


Buffalo, United States Five Star Bank Full time

Compensation for this role is primarily variable and based on commissions.

Position Title: Mortgage Originator

Reports To: Regional Mortgage Sales Manager

Department: Residential Lending

FLSA Status: Non-Exempt

Purpose: At Five Star Bank, our people are our greatest competitive advantage. As a Mortgage Loan Originator, you will use your expert knowledge of mortgage products and services and an advice-led approach to deliver personalized residential real estate solutions and build lasting relationships. As a Mortgage Loan Originator, you will drive productive sales and service activities, develop new business by educating existing and potential clients and exemplify Five Star Bank's HEART values. The ideal candidate will possess a referral source network and/or target audience whose mortgage needs can be satisfied with a traditional array of products sold on the secondary market including but not limited to Freddie Mac, FHA, VA, USDA and SONYMA.

Supervisory Responsibilities:

Degree of Supervision Received: Minimal

  • Supervision Received (title): Regional Mortgage Sales Manager
Degree of Supervision Given: NA
  • Supervision Given to (Titles): NA
Essential Functions:
  1. Develops new business by cultivating leads from external referral sources such as realtors, home builders, attorneys, and financial planners. Maintains an ongoing relationship with these sources to foster ongoing referral business.
  2. Works with internal business partners such as branch staff, commercial lenders, small business lenders and wealth management staff, to identify prospects and leads. Stays knowledgeable on Bank products and services and actively contributes to business development goals through cross sell opportunities, submitting referrals to other lines of business.
  3. Keeps current and compliant with industry standards and government regulations and serves as subject matter expertise with all mortgage products such as Freddie Mac, Sonyma, VA, FHA, and USDA. Adheres to bank policies and procedures.
  4. Actively promotes Five Star Bank projecting a positive and professional image through participation in relevant community and professional activities to expand and enhance networking opportunities for generation of leads and community interest.
  5. Interviews loan applicants and assists applicants with identifying the products that best meet their needs. Collects financial data & documents and submits a complete loan application for processing. Monitors the loan process from origination to closing acting in the role of liaison between the Bank and the applicant.
  6. The CRM tool for Five Star Bank is Salesforce. The originator will receive training on the system and is expected to know how to send and receive referrals from this system. They are expected to use Salesforce in their daily correspondence with other internal partners at the Bank.
  7. Demonstrates the standards and principles of the Five Star Bank experience in every interaction with internal and external customers and associates. Incorporates the high performance behaviors of teamwork, leading by example and service in every facet of work.
Job Related Qualifications - Education and Prior Experience:

Required:
  • Education: High School Diploma
  • Prior Experience: 3+ years in the financial services industry
  • Licenses or Accreditation: Register with Nationwide Mortgage Licensing System Registry (NMLS) and obtain a unique identifier that is provided to consumers in accordance with all SAFE Act requirements.
